With more than four decades of existence, Frontal Magazine has been — and continues to be — a milestone in the academic life of NOVA Medical School. Integrated into the Student Association, this project is the result of the commitment and involvement of Medicine and Nutrition students, functioning as a platform for expression and sharing a love of writing.
To celebrate its history and recognize its relevance over time, on November 3, at 6 p.m., Frontal and the NOVA Medical School Library will inaugurate the exhibition “FRONTAL: Decades on Paper,” which will present, for the first time, the complete collection of its printed editions, from its creation to the present day.

To see all the editions of this project — which now includes the 55th edition of the magazine, launched in October 2025 — is to revisit the history of NOVA Medical School, as well as the various meanings that being a student at this institution has taken on over the course of these 42 years.
The exhibition can be visited during the normal opening hours of the NOVA Medical School Library, between 9 a.m. and 6 p.m.
